Sand production line in Tanzania

Production capacity: 50–500 t/h;

Materials processed: river pebbles, granite, basalt, iron ore, limestone, etc.;

Equipment configuration: vibrating feeder, jaw crusher, direct-through impact crusher (sand-making machine), vibrating screen, sand washer, belt conveyor, centralised electrical control system, and other equipment.

Production Line Overview:

Raw stone is transported via a vibrating feeder to the jaw crusher for crushing (also known as primary crushing or coarse crushing). If the particle size does not meet the standard, secondary crushing is required. The material is then conveyed by a belt conveyor to the vibrating screen for screening. Qualified material enters the sand-making machine for sand production, whilst non-compliant material is returned to the feeder for another round of crushing. Material exiting the sand-making machine enters the sand washer for cleaning; the washed river pebbles constitute the finished product and are ready for packaging and dispatch. Otherwise, repeated cycles of production are required to achieve a higher degree of sand-making precision.
